Introducing the 50-57-9002 SL Crimp Housing, a versatile connectivity solution for your electronic projects. This Single Row housing, Version A, features 2 Circuits in a sleek Black design, perfect for signal applications. Constructed from durable Polyester Alloy, it offers reliable performance in a wide operating temperature range from -40 to 105 °C. With a 2.54 mm pitch, this non-polarized connector is stackable, providing flexibility in your wire-to-board setups. RoHS compliant and with a connector system suitable for wire-to-wire or wire-to-board connections, the SL Crimp Housing is a must-have component for your projects. Available for immediate shipment.
